On 1 July 2022, NHS North Central London Integrated Care Board (NCL ICB) was established. The ICB is part of North Central London Integrated Care System (ICS). The ICS is a partnership of organisations that come together to plan and deliver joined up health and care services to improve the lives of people in our five boroughs: Barnet, Camden, Enfield, Haringey and Islington.

ICBs are statutory NHS bodies responsible for planning and allocating resources to meet the four core purposes of ICSs:
•    to improve outcomes in population health and healthcare
•    tackle inequalities in outcomes, experience and access
•    enhance productivity and value for money 
•    help the NHS support broader social and economic development.

North Central London’s population is incredibly diverse, and continues to grow and change. This brings pressure and challenges for the local health and care services that NCL ICB commissions – or buys – on behalf of residents. NCL ICB works closely with Councils, providers, general practices, voluntary, community organisations, and unions, to achieve our shared aims.

NCL ICB values our staff, our partners and their expertise to deliver the best health and care possible for the patients and residents of North Central London.

Job overview

We are seeking a highly organised, experienced and positive individual to join our team as our Information Manager and provide maternity cover from August 2024.

 

The Information Manager is responsible for day-to-day management of the Complaints and Enquiries Team - this is the central point of contact for complaints, concerns, MP enquiries, compliments and feedback about services commissioned by NCL ICB. The team is also responsible for managing all MP enquiries, and liaising with MPs and Councillors who are raising concerns on behalf of their constituents.

 

We are looking for an experienced Information Manager with excellent communication and interpersonal skills, and the ability to build strong relationships with Executive Directors, other senior colleagues, and the wider ICB teams. The post holder will be highly skilled at managing databases and running detailed reports, suitable for a variety of audiences.

Main duties of the job

The Information Manager has an important and challenging role, and will lead on:

 

The management of the complaints and MP enquiries process and the implementation of associated policies and procedures

Managing our new complaints database and running reports from this; including developing the database and aligning policies and procedures

Analysing and monitoring performance data, capacity and demand data and producing reports and analysis to a wide range of Committees and meetings.

Providing support to the Senior Information Risk Owner (SIRO) to ensure that the ICB operates within legal and ethical frameworks for all complaints, concerns, and MP enquiries. 

Reviewing internal processes and embedding a culture of continuous improvement, having recently (July 2023) taken on the delegated responsibility of the primary care complaints function, from NHS England.
